Description
Snicker Apple Salad is a delightful and easy-to-make dessert salad combining crisp Granny Smith apples, chopped Snickers bars, and a creamy vanilla pudding whipped topping mixture. This chilled salad offers a perfect balance of tartness from the apples and rich sweetness from the candy bars, making it an ideal treat for gatherings or as a simple indulgence.
Ingredients

Fruit
- 4 medium Granny Smith apples, diced
Dessert Mix
- 4 Snickers bars, chopped into small pieces
- 1 (8 oz) tub whipped topping
- 1 (5.1 oz) package vanilla instant pudding mix
- 1 cup milk
Optional
- 1/2 teaspoon lemon juice (optional, to prevent apples from browning)
Instructions
- Prepare pudding base: In a medium-sized bowl, whisk together the vanilla instant pudding mix and milk until the mixture is smooth and thickened. Let it sit for 5 minutes to allow the pudding to firm up properly.
- Incorporate whipped topping: Gently fold the whipped topping into the pudding mixture until fully combined, creating a light and creamy base for the salad.
- Add fruits and candy: Add the diced Granny Smith apples and chopped Snickers bars into the bowl. Optionally, add lemon juice to prevent the apples from browning. Gently stir everything together to evenly distribute the ingredients.
- Chill the salad: Refrigerate the salad for at least 1 hour before serving to allow the flavors to meld and the texture to set.
- Serve and enjoy: Serve the Snicker Apple Salad chilled for a refreshing and sweet dessert experience.
Notes
- Using lemon juice helps prevent apples from browning, but it’s optional.
- For best results, make the salad a few hours ahead to let flavors meld well.
- You can substitute the whipped topping with homemade whipped cream if preferred.
- For a variation, try adding chopped nuts like walnuts or pecans for added crunch.
